라이브 데이터를 통한 Web Components 고성능
Ignite UI for Web Components 데이터 테이블/데이터 그리드는 라이브 데이터 시나리오의 고성능에 최적화되어 있습니다. 빠른 로드 시간, 지연 시간 또는 화면 깜박임 없이 부드러운 스크롤을 통해 그리드의 열과 행에 대한 완전한 가상화를 통해 Web Components 데이터 그리드 애플리케이션에서 무제한의 행과 열을 원활하게 스크롤할 수 있습니다.
Web Components 라이브 데이터를 통한 고성능 예시
이 샘플은 수천 개의 재무 기록을 Web Components 데이터 그리드에 바인딩하고 1개의 열로 그룹화하여(예: Territory)를 사용하고 몇 밀리초마다 여러 열을 실시간으로 업데이트합니다. 다양한 옵션을 실시간으로 변경하고 지연, 화면 깜박임 또는 시각적 지연 없이 Data Grid 성능을 변경할 수 있습니다
